Review Summary and Plot Commentary about Hairspray
Hairspray is the story of Tracy Turnblad, a chubby Baltimore teenager in the early '60s whose only dream is to be on a local television dance party program, The Corny Collins Show. She gets her wish, only to discover the show's race barrier and become the bitter enemy of pro-segregation princess Amber Von Tussle. After many loopy adventures, including a few days in juvenile hall, Tracy and Amber compete in a hilarious dance-off and the Corny Collins Show ends its policy of segregation.
